Lamasan family refuses autopsy, delaying probe into vice mayor's death

The family of Dueñas Vice Mayor Aimee Paz Lamasan has refused to allow an autopsy on her remains, hampering the police investigation into her death.

Lamasan's live-in partner, former OCD Region VIII director Lord Byron Torrecarion, has also not yet complied with a request for a paraffin test.

The alleged accidental firing occurred on December 30, 2025, with Lamasan succumbing to her injury on New Year's Eve.

Police initially reported that Lamasan died on January 1 after being shot in the stomach while allegedly putting away a 9mm pistol in her residence in La Paz, Iloilo City.

A Special Investigation Team (SIT) has been formed by the Police Regional Office VI to investigate the incident.

The family has requested privacy as they grieve, and media have been barred from the wake.
